Materials Manager Jobs in USA with Visa Sponsorship
Materials managers coordinate procurement, inventory, and supply chain operations across manufacturing, healthcare, and technology companies. This role typically qualifies for H-1B visa, E-3 visa, and TN visa sponsorship as a specialty occupation requiring specialized business knowledge. Job Summary:
In this role, you will lead a team and support material planning and/or material coordination for a project. Planning involves providing work process and system expertise during the early project stages. Coordination will include communicating material availability, accuracy, and timeliness to the correct location. Your team will ensure the location receives the required materials to complete the project.

Major Responsibilities:
- Manage a team of Lead materials coordination or planners on a large project or works within business line Supply Chain department in a functional role in a small to medium sized GBU
- Provides expertise, advice, and direction for project and field materials management activities to ensure the overall organizational effectiveness among all functions responsible for the materials management process
- Reviews the initial master schedule, detailed timing and sequence of each functional group, and actual progress of each group to confirm that materials meet required delivery dates
- Reviews any schedule revisions for impacts and participates in the development of contingency planning
- Interfaces between Construction and Supply Chain to identify, requisition and establish delivery dates for material requirements resulting from design changes, rework, contingency/work arounds, scope changes, or materials missed in Engineering takeoffs
- Reviews plans at the jobsite for adequacy of material warehousing, maintenance, control, and handling
- Coordinates with Construction and Field Supply Chain the plans for material identification, material availability in support of installation plans, and equipment requiring special handling at the site
- Formulates specialized training and career development programs necessary to assure that all assigned material management personnel are properly trained and qualified

Emphasize supply chain optimization experience
Highlight specific experience with ERP systems, inventory management software, and supply chain optimization. Quantify cost savings, efficiency improvements, or inventory reduction achievements to demonstrate specialized knowledge employers value.
Target manufacturing and healthcare sectors
Manufacturing companies, medical device firms, and pharmaceutical organizations frequently need materials managers and actively sponsor visas. These industries understand the specialized knowledge required for regulatory compliance and supply chain management.
Highlight degree-role alignment clearly
Materials management roles require business, engineering, or supply chain degrees. Clearly connect your education to the position's specialized requirements, especially if you have industrial engineering, operations management, or MBA credentials.
Demonstrate regulatory compliance knowledge
Experience with FDA regulations, ISO standards, or automotive quality requirements strengthens your case. This specialized knowledge is difficult to find and helps justify the need for your specific expertise over domestic candidates.
Show multi-site coordination experience
Companies with multiple locations need materials managers who can coordinate across facilities. Experience managing distributed supply chains, vendor relationships, or international procurement demonstrates valuable specialized skills that support visa applications.
Include procurement and vendor management
Strong vendor negotiation, contract management, and supplier relationship experience shows specialized business knowledge. Highlight experience with strategic sourcing, supplier audits, or procurement process improvements that reduce costs or improve quality.

Do materials manager positions qualify for H-1B visa sponsorship?
Yes, materials manager positions typically qualify for H-1B sponsorship as specialty occupations requiring specialized business knowledge in supply chain management, procurement, and inventory optimization. The role requires understanding of ERP systems, regulatory compliance, and vendor management that goes beyond general business knowledge. Manufacturing, healthcare, and technology companies regularly sponsor these positions.
What degree do I need for materials manager visa sponsorship?
Most materials manager positions require a bachelor's degree in business administration, industrial engineering, supply chain management, operations management, or a related field. Some positions accept degrees in mechanical or electrical engineering, especially in manufacturing environments. An MBA can strengthen applications, particularly for senior materials management roles requiring strategic procurement knowledge.
Which industries sponsor materials managers most frequently?
Manufacturing companies, medical device firms, pharmaceutical organizations, and aerospace companies sponsor materials managers most often. These industries have complex supply chains requiring specialized knowledge of regulatory compliance, quality standards, and vendor management. Technology companies, automotive manufacturers, and defense contractors also regularly sponsor these positions due to specialized procurement requirements.
Can I get TN visa sponsorship as a materials manager from Canada or Mexico?
Materials managers can qualify for TN status under the Management Consultant category if the role involves analyzing and recommending improvements to business processes, supply chain operations, or procurement systems. The position must be temporary and require specialized knowledge of business management principles. Permanent materials management roles typically don't qualify for TN status.
What makes materials manager positions attractive to visa sponsors?
Materials managers directly impact company profitability through cost reduction, inventory optimization, and supply chain efficiency improvements. The role requires specialized knowledge of procurement systems, vendor management, and regulatory compliance that's difficult to find domestically. Companies understand the business case for sponsoring candidates who can demonstrate measurable improvements in supply chain performance and cost management.

What is the prevailing wage requirement for sponsored Materials Manager jobs?
U.S. employers sponsoring a visa must pay at least the prevailing wage, which is what workers in the same role, area, and experience level typically earn. The Department of Labor sets this rate to make sure companies aren't hiring foreign workers simply because they'd accept lower pay than a U.S. worker. It varies by job title, location, and experience. You can look up current prevailing wage rates for any occupation and location using the OFLC Wage Search page.
